1223X2210X - Orofacial Pain Dentistry
1223X2210X is the NUCC provider taxonomy code for Orofacial Pain Dentistry, a specialization within Dentist (individual providers). 252 providers in our latest NPPES snapshot list it as their primary taxonomy.
Code breakdown
Definition
A dentist who assesses, diagnoses, and treats patients with complex chronic orofacial pain and dysfunction disorders, oromotor and jaw behavior disorders, and chronic head/neck pain. The dentist has successfully completed an accredited postdoctoral orofacial pain residency training program for dentists of two or more years duration, in accord with the Commission on Dental Accreditation's Standards for Orofacial Pain Residency Programs, and/or meets the requirements for examination and board certification by the American Board of Orofacial Pain.
Definition from the N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y code set.
